+sizeof() can return a long or an int, so neither printf("%d",sizeof(blah));
+or printf("%ld",sizeof(blah)); can be used everywhere. Changed the
+"sizeofs" section of SHOW FEATURES in the dumbest (and therefore most
+portable) way to squelch the warnings. ckuus5.c, 17 Jun 2011.

+More important he knew how to force gcc to load the right header files for
+OpenSSL 1.0.0d (by using '-isystem' rather than '-I'). Previously it was
+using the 0.9.8r header files but linking with the 1.0.0d libraries. This
+is not in the sources, it's done in the 'make' command, e.g.:
+
+ export PATH=/usr/bin:$PATH
+ export SSLINC=-isystem/usr/include
+ export "SSLLIB=-L/usr/lib -Wl,-rpath,/usr/lib"
+ make linux+ssl

+For the pluggable-disk OS's that boot OK but lack a working network, I
+rigged up a serial connection using a DB9-FF null modem cable, and then a
+DB9-MF modem cable to make it reach. I don't see any modem signals on
+either end, but the data goes through OK. COM1 on the desktop PC,
+/dev/ttyS1 or whatever on Lab. Since there are no modem signals, can't use
+RTS/CTS. At 57600bps with Xon/Xoff, 500-byte packets and sliding windows,
+transfers work OK at about 5000cps using 5 window slots; takes 8 minutes to
+transfer the gzipped C-Kermit tarball. Kermit to the rescue. 19 Jun 2011.

+When using compact substring notation, \s(xx[4]) returns the whole string
+xx starting at position 4, but \s(xx[4:]) returns an empty string. Fixed
+the latter to be like the former. ckuus5.c, 20 Jun 2010.
+
+Really it would have been nicer if \s(xx[4]) returned a single character,
+the 4th character of xx, but it's too late now. Added another "separator"
+character '.' (period) for that: \s(xx[4.]) is the 4th character of xx.
+ckuus4.c, 20 Jun 2010.

+Back to SCO OSR5.0.7... This failed before because 'rdchk' came up unknown
+at link time, unlike all previous OSR5's, that used rdchk() in place of the
+FIONREAD ioctl. Added #ifdefs to make a special case for 5.0.7. I'm not
+sure this is the best way, but this is the minimal change to get it to work.
+If anybody cares, maybe the same can be done for previous OSR5 releases.
+ckutio.c, 20 Jun 2010 (search for SCO_OSR507).

+I found a Linux box that had both Kerberos 4 and 5 installed and tried 'make
+linux+krb5+krb4', which failed because of missing DES functions. Tried
+'make linux+krb5+krb4 KFLAGS=-UCK_DES', but that fails too, even though it
+doesn't fail for Kerberos 5 alone, so probably some Krb4 code is making
+unguarded calls to the DES routines. What is really needed is a way to
+completely strip all DES references from any given build. 21 Jun 2011.
